“…Focused ion beam milling and scanning electron microscopy serial sectioning can be combined with several labeling methods. These include genetic labeling ( Bosch et al, 2015 , 2016 ) tract-tracing ( Rodriguez-Moreno et al, 2018 , 2020 ) and immunocytochemistry ( Turégano-López et al, 2021 ). These methods allow the researcher to select a group of cells based on their origin, projections, or neurochemical characteristics.…”

“…Subsequently, we used FIB-SEM to image cortical regions with VGAT-positive puncta, identifying synapses based on VGAT-positive boutons and unlabeled terminals. This material was prepared without potassium ferrocyanide, and the AS and SS were clearly identified and distinguished from one another (Turégano-López et al, 2021). However, volume electron microscopy studies have commonly employed potassium ferrocyanide Stevens, 1988, 1989;Harris et al, 1992Harris et al, , 2015Medalla et al, 2007;Hua et al, 2015) or potassium ferricyanide (Tapia et al, 2012).…”
